LizVega wrote:
> The reason I believe there was someone else there is twofold:
> 1. If no one else was there, how did LV get his wand back in GOF?
AF:
Well, there's nothing saying Voldemort physically turned to
rubble after the attack. He may have been extremely weakened but
regular human beings have done physically astounding things too
based on their physical limitations and capabilities. I thought he
fled straight out.
Taryn:
"My curse was deflected by the woman's foolish sacrifice, and it rebounded upon myslef. Aaah...pain beyond pain, my friends; nothing could have prepared me for it. I was ripped from my body, I was less than spirit, less than the meanest ghost...but still, I was alive. <...> Nevertheless, I was as powerless as the weakest creature alive, and without the means to help myself...for I had no body, and every spell that might have helped me required the use of a wand..." [GoF American Paperback, pg. 653]
Straight from the horse's mouth.
